A knee-jerk test can be used to evaluate which system?

Explanation:
The knee-jerk test, also known as the patellar reflex test, is primarily used to evaluate the functioning of the nervous system. This test assesses the integrity of the reflex arc, which involves sensory and motor pathways that are part of the nervous system. When the patellar tendon is tapped, it causes a reflex action resulting in the contraction of the quadriceps muscle, which is an involuntary response. This reflex is a simple pathway that helps to reveal the health of the nervous system, particularly the spinal cord and various nerve pathways involved in reflex actions. Thus, the knee-jerk test is a crucial tool in diagnosing potential issues within the nervous system, distinguishing it from the other systems mentioned, such as digestive, cardiovascular, and respiratory. These systems are evaluated through different means specific to their functions and pathologies.
